1. International standards build industry discourse power
The international standard for TCM infrared moxibustion instrument (ISO 20493), led by Shanghai University of Traditional Chinese Medicine, has for the first time clarified the technical parameters and clinical application specifications of TCM infrared equipment. After 41 months of demonstration by experts from five countries including China, Australia and Canada, the standard successfully transformed the efficacy characteristics of traditional moxibustion such as "heat penetration and heat expansion" into quantifiable technical indicators. As of 2024, my country has led the release of 31 international standards for TCM, covering acupuncture instruments, quality of Chinese medicinal materials and other fields, laying a standardized foundation for the global promotion of moxibustion robots.

3. Industry collaboration promotes sustainable development
In order to break through the application bottleneck in specialized fields such as tumors, the China Institute of Atomic Energy has cooperated with medical institutions to develop an intelligent collaborative system to reproduce the personalized moxibustion method of famous old TCM doctors through deep learning. The system can support the treatment of 5-10 patients at the same time, freeing doctors from repetitive operations and focusing on the diagnosis and treatment of complex cases. In addition, the industry is exploring the "robot + Internet hospital" model to achieve cross-border health management services through remote diagnosis and treatment platforms.
